Normandy and Brittany Europe
Dieppe
Dieppe
The bike, parked under the watchful eye of the Chateau.
Earlier this month, we had a wonderful tour of north-west France on our Honda Deauville. We took Le Shuttle to Coquelles and headed off down to the Hotel Aguado in Dieppe for a couple of nights. The weather was great (I swam in the sea) and the food amazing. Our next stop was the Ibis in Port-en-Bessin, a picturesque fishing port near Omaha Beach. Tintern Abbey Europe
Abbey and valley
Abbey and valley
The ruins with the beautiful Wye Valley as a backdrop
Tintern Abbey is set on the banks of the River Wye in Monmouthshire. It was founded by the Cistercian order in 1131 and is a fine example of Gothic architecture. Wordsworth wrote about it; Turner painted it; the photos tell their own story. [View Full Entry]
